Established in the summer of 1976, the Moscow Farmers Market is the premier Saturday community event on the Palouse. The Market is located on portions of Main, 5th, and 4th Streets, May through October, 8:00 a.m. – 1:00 p.m., rain or shine. Residents and visitors can find local and regional agricultural products, distinctive handmade goods, artisan pieces, and original-recipe cuisine. Live entertainment, children’s programming and special events in Friendship Square add to the lively and inclusive atmosphere. Visit to see what makes our Farmers Market one of the top twenty-five nationally recognized markets in the U.S.! The Market is a pet-, nicotine-, and solicitation-free event; ADA service dogs welcome. SNAP/EBT benefits are accepted through the Shop The Market program, as well as Washington State WIC and Senior nutrition benefits.
